While stationed in iraq i decided to get a T Maxx. Break in was a dream. No problems at all.:D I've been trying to get it tuned for a few days now. It starts with ease. As i lean the high speed i dont see any noticably increase in preformance. But after about 20 mins of running and leaning i noticed the blue smoke was gone. And my temp was 360.:angry: So i cut her off and let her cool as well as richen her up about 1/8 turn. I then ran it with the body off and she ran around 210. But with the body on its running alot higher. I dont understand how this is so seeing how I've cut holes in the pass side of the front window to increase air flow. Any who i started messing with the low speed and when i pinched it it took about 3 seconds to die but didnt sound like it ideled up any. So i leaned it out and it got better finaly i got it to where it was preforming better. Doing wheelies on comand like I've heard and running quick. But when i do the pinch test it only takes about 2 seconds to die with no increase in idle. So i put the body back on and started running around. After about 6 or 7 high speed rins i checked my temp and it was 320. So i killed it and let it cool. I'm starting to get frustrated!:angry:
 
Your lsn is lean. nothing you can do to the hsn will fix that. richen it up 1/8 of an turn and try from there
 
If I understand , part of the problem is the engine getting hot when you put the body back on? I lived in Arizona and ran my truck in 110 degree plus weather. I had to put a good sized hole in the windshield and trimmed the body up in front and cut out the "tailgate" to get some good airflow going across the head. this got my temp down to normal. I hope this helps.:)
 
After I cut MANY holes in my body(to the point it looked like swiss cheeze), the temp would not come down with the body on(gravedigger body). Turns out it was an air leak where the thing that holds the carb in. I have no idea why it would run okay(250-265) whith the body off. I guess it was just that little bit of extra airflow.
